lib/dynamic_supervisor/proxy.ex

defmodule DynamicSupervisor.Proxy do
defmacro __using__(options) do
alias = options[:alias]
if alias do
quote do
use DynamicSupervisor
alias unquote(__MODULE__), as: unquote(alias)
require unquote(alias)
end
else
quote do
use DynamicSupervisor
import unquote(__MODULE__)
end
end
end
@doc """
Starts a module-based supervisor process with the given `module` and `init_arg`. Will wait a bit if the supervisor name is still registered on restarts. See: [Supervisor restart backoff](https://github.com/erlang/otp/pull/1287).
To start the supervisor, the `init/1` callback will be invoked in the given
`module`, with `init_arg` as its argument. The `init/1` callback must return
a supervisor specification which can be created with the help of the `init/1`
function.
The `:name` option must be given in order to register a supervisor name.
## Examples
use DynamicSupervisor.Proxy
def start_link(:ok), do: start_link(DynSup, :ok, name: DynSup)
"""
defmacro start_link(module, init_arg, opts) do
quote bind_quoted: [mod: module, arg: init_arg, opts: opts] do
DynamicSupervisor.Proxy.Broker.start_link(mod, arg, opts)
end
end
end
